Mekelle Industrial Zone power station is a 500 MW gas power station in Tigray, Ethiopia. It is operated by Turkish Industry Holding [100%]. Based on its capacity (estimated), it can supply roughly 563k homes (estimated). It ranks #2 of 15 Ethiopia power plants by installed capacity. In context, gas supplies about 0.0% of Ethiopia's electricity; the national grid averages 23 gCO₂/kWh (100.0% low-carbon) (2025).

Gas plants burn natural gas either in open-cycle turbines for fast peaking, or in combined-cycle units that recover exhaust heat in an HRSG to reach roughly 55–62% efficiency — the cleanest-burning fossil option.
